## Authentication

The Lanternfall canary gate evaluates promotion rules against live error budgets before widening a rollout. As on-call, you may need to query or override a gate decision during an incident. All gate API calls require authentication; anonymous reads were disabled after the Q3 audit. Overrides are logged and paged to the deploy channel, so use them sparingly and document your reasoning in the incident thread. To authenticate against the internal gating service, use the key provided below.

service key, fawip-bajef: kto11_Qt5wZK9vdNC

14:22 — The Profilecrest sharding migration entered phase three, moving write traffic to the new hash-ring topology. Plugin authors should note that lookups against legacy shard paths began returning stale reads at this point, which explains the inconsistent avatar data several external integrations reported. The compatibility shim was not yet active; it landed eleven minutes later. Any plugin caching shard assignments locally would have served wrong data during this window. The migration ran under the deployment identified below.

trace token, fafog-kageg: htk4_98e6

**Mgmt Meeting Minutes — Retiring the Brightline Range**

Quick recap for sales leads at Fenholt Supplies: we agreed to retire the Brightline fixture range by year-end. Remaining stock moves to clearance pricing next month, and accounts on standing orders get migrated to the Lumetta range. Trade-in incentives were approved in principle. The confidential note on next steps sits just below.

board note of bajof-bajeg: The pricing group signed off on a budget of $13.4 million for Project Sildor. The renewal with Lamixek Holdings closes at $48.9 million a year, 49 percent above the last contract.

Subject: Quickstore 4.2 — bloom filter now fronts the KV layer

Plugin authors: starting with this release, Quickstore places a bloom filter ahead of the key-value store. Negative lookups return faster; false positives fall through safely. No API changes are required on your side. Verify your plugin against the staging build referenced below.

session token of fahif-tadup = htk3_9c7